Size- Part No.- Tyre - Shared with -
Fuchs Front - 7Jx15 ET23 -911 361 020 41 - 215/60 VR15 - 911 SC
Fuchs Front (option) - 7Jx16 ET23 - 911 362 115 00 - 205/55 VR16 - 911 SC
Fuchs Rear - 8Jx16 ET23 - 911 362 117 00- 225/50 VR16 - 930 _________________ 1980 931 - forged pistons, Piper cam, K27/26 3257 6.10 hybrid turbo, 951 FMIC, custom intake, Mittelmotor dizzy & cam pulley, H&S exhaust, GAZ Gold, Fuch'ed, Quaife

So the offset is measured from the centreline of the wheel to where it actually fits up to the hub, sweet so the bigger the positive offset the further out the mounting and the smaller the "Dish" of the rim.
Inversly the smaller or even negative offset has a "Deeper" Dish

The 911 8X16s have a 10.6ET
The 951 8X16 have the 23.3ET
The Carrera GT usually came with the optional 7X16 and 8X16 911 offset wheels.
The ultimate setup to fill the wheel wells would be 911 offset 8X16s in the front and the 9X16s with additional 5mm spacers in the rear. _________________ 1981 931 CGT replica, OEM CGT intercooler, .8 BAR WG spring, GTS Headlights, Innovative Wide band A/F, A/C delete, 16" Fuchs, Weltmeister 200lb lowering springs, Bilstein HDs front, Koni Sport rears. |
